Procedures and Phases of Environmental Impact Assessments in Oil and Gas Projects
The procedures and phases of environmental impact assessments in oil and gas projects typically follow a structured process to ensure comprehensive evaluation. This process generally includes several key stages:
-
Screening and Scoping: This initial phase determines whether an EIA is required and identifies key concerns and study boundaries. It ensures relevant environmental issues are prioritized and incorporated early.
-
Impact Analysis and Reporting: Developers conduct detailed assessments of potential environmental impacts, including air quality, water resources, biodiversity, and social effects. A comprehensive report documents these findings for review.
-
Public Participation and Consultation: Engaging stakeholders, including local communities and authorities, is critical. Public consultations review the findings, provide feedback, and incorporate community perspectives into project planning.
-
Decision-Making and Monitoring: Authorities evaluate the EIA report and determine project approval conditions. Post-approval, monitoring ensures compliance and evaluates actual environmental impacts during project implementation.
Screening and Scoping Processes
The screening process initiates the environmental impact assessment laws by determining whether an oil and gas infrastructure project requires a full assessment. It involves reviewing project size, location, and potential environmental risks to categorize its importance.
During scoping, authorities and stakeholders identify key issues and environmental concerns relevant to the project. This phase outlines the scope of the impact assessment, including specific areas such as biodiversity, water resources, and land use.
Scoping establishes the boundaries of the assessment, focusing on significant impacts and methods for evaluation. It ensures that all relevant environmental factors are considered early in project planning, facilitating efficient and targeted analysis.
Overall, these processes are fundamental in environmental impact assessment laws, guiding developers and regulators in early-stage decision-making to minimize ecological harm associated with oil and gas infrastructure projects.

Special Considerations in Laws Pertaining to Offshore and Onshore Oil Infrastructure
Laws governing offshore and onshore oil infrastructure must address diverse environmental challenges unique to each setting. Offshore activities require stringent regulations to protect marine ecosystems from oil spills, ballast water discharge, and noise pollution. These laws emphasize marine and coastal environment protections, ensuring that offshore developments do not threaten biodiversity or disrupt marine habitats.
Onshore oil infrastructure laws focus on land use and biodiversity conservation. They mandate assessments of land degradation, habitat destruction, and potential impacts on local flora and fauna. These laws also set regulations for waste management, emissions, and pollution control to mitigate environmental harm caused by onshore drilling and refining activities.
Both offshore and onshore laws prioritize public participation, requiring consultation with local communities and stakeholders. They also consider legal obligations related to disaster response, spill prevention, and habitat restoration, reflecting a comprehensive approach tailored to the distinct environmental sensitivities of each setting.

Challenges and Limitations of Current Environmental Impact Assessment Laws
Current environmental impact assessment laws face several challenges that hinder effective implementation in the oil and gas sector. One significant issue is the inconsistency in legal frameworks across jurisdictions, which can lead to gaps in coverage and enforcement.
Limited scope and outdated provisions may fail to address emerging environmental concerns related to offshore and onshore oil infrastructure, reducing the laws’ relevance over time.
Additionally, procedural complexities often cause delays, as lengthy assessment processes can discourage compliance or lead to superficial evaluations. Public participation may also be limited by inadequate consultation mechanisms, weakening stakeholder engagement.
Key challenges include:
- Jurisdictional inconsistencies and lack of harmonization.
- Outdated or insufficient legal provisions.
- Procedural delays and bureaucratic hurdles.
- Limited public participation and transparency issues.
These limitations collectively reduce the effectiveness of environmental impact assessments, requiring ongoing legal reform and stronger enforcement mechanisms to adequately protect the environment in oil and gas projects.
Recent Developments and Future Trends in EIA Laws for Oil and Gas Projects
Recent developments in environmental impact assessment laws for oil and gas projects reflect a global shift towards greater environmental protection and sustainability. Many jurisdictions are integrating international best practices, emphasizing transparency, public participation, and comprehensive impact analysis. These updates often involve stricter requirements for baseline environmental data and risk assessments, ensuring that projects account for cumulative and long-term effects.
Future trends indicate an increased reliance on technological advancements, such as remote sensing, GIS tools, and AI, to improve the accuracy and efficiency of EIA processes. There is also a growing focus on climate change considerations, mandating assessments of greenhouse gas emissions and climate resilience strategies within oil and gas infrastructure projects. Furthermore, laws are gradually incorporating stricter regulations for offshore and marine environments, emphasizing biodiversity conservation and marine ecosystem management.
Overall, evolving EIA laws for oil and gas aim to balance developmental needs with environmental sustainability, driven by international commitments and increased societal awareness. These developments are set to shape more rigorous, transparent, and adaptive frameworks for future oil and gas project assessments.
